Output e97aa5a9f84cc65e5edaabea402d12012f03d9a1e1979b6e4830328834739901:39

value
173189
script pubkey
OP_0 OP_PUSHBYTES_32 8df43c12dd266d0f488e2f64dc9d0d3c6933287e8974e1027db3e38a516d3ed8
address
bc1q3h6rcykayeks7jyw9ajde8gd835nx2r7396wzqnak03c55td8mvqnvc7dj
transaction
e97aa5a9f84cc65e5edaabea402d12012f03d9a1e1979b6e4830328834739901
confirmations
162403
spent
true